And speaking of going from cold to hot and back again, the Venus Freeze facial is a procedure that’s earning itself an army of supporters worldwide. This is a heat-based treatment which aims to boost collagen and ‘freeze’ the ageing process – what woman wouldn’t love to do that?

It may be called a freeze but the treatment is actually a heat-based facial, with a high-tech machine delivering radiofrequ­ency energy and magnetic pulses into the skin to tighten and refine its contours.

The radiofrequ­ency energy waves deliver enough heat to the skin to kick-start production of new collagen and elastin and encourage skin to become firmer, plumper and more springy – basically it causes a thermal response in the skin’s tissue activating the body’s natural healing response and self-repair mechanism. RF waves also shrink existing collagen in the skin to tighten it.

thoroughly cleanses my skin and covers it in a special glycerin that acts as a protective barrier between the machine and my face – the skin has to reach 39C or more to make collagen shrink. She then moves the head of the machine around in a very gentle motion.

I had heard in the past that radio-frequency treatments were particular­ly painful, but the total opposite is the case with Venus Freeze.

I’m so relaxed, I actually doze off several times – it feels like a hot-stone massage on your face. Heavenly.

After the first 40 minutes, I’m not expecting radical results but am pleasantly surprised to see my skin definitely looks smoother. My forehead was definitely less wrinkled and my jawline more defined. There’s also less crepiness on my neck – the giveaway for so many women.

There’s no downtime from the treatment, and I returned to work straight afterwards – I was even able to put make-up on. Adrienne advised that I’d see the best results after three treatments and this was definitely the case.

After eight treatments, my entire face and neck areas are noticeably smoother and the crease between my brows – the result of years of scowling and squinting – has reduced a lot.
